There are 118 calories in 1 small or thin cut Pork Chop (Lean and Fat Eaten).
Calorie Breakdown: 54% fat, 0% carbs, 46% prot.

Common serving sizes:

Serving Size Calories
1 oz, with bone (yield after cooking, bone removed) 40
1 oz boneless (yield after cooking) 52
1 oz, with bone cooked (yield after bone removed) 55
1 oz boneless, cooked 71
1 small or thin cut (3 oz, with bone, raw) (yield after cooking, bone removed) 118
1 medium (5.5 oz, with bone, raw) (yield after cooking, bone removed) 218
100 g 250
1 large (8 oz, with bone, raw) (yield after cooking, bone removed) 318
